14:02 — Someone flagged that avatars uploaded through Petalboard still carried GPS tags. Oops. 14:10 — Confirmed the EXIF scrubber in the Inkwell media pipeline was silently skipping HEIC files after last week's codec bump. 14:25 — Hotfix written: scrub runs before format conversion, not after. 14:50 — Backfill job kicked off to rescrub the last nine days of uploads. 15:30 — Spot checks clean; no tags surviving. Fix is verified in the build stamped below.

build token for kahop-kagep: htk6_72fc45

Meeting Notes — Branch Server Replacement

Agreed: the failing rack unit at the Dunlowe branch will be swapped for the new Ferrox T40 on Thursday. IT will image the machine beforehand; the old drive stays on site for secure wiping. Courier collects the boxed server at 08:30 from reception. The confidential hand-over instruction for the courier follows below.

handover note for yagef-bagep: the drudor pelius courier leaves the kasdor zorvan norir ledger at gate 8016 under passcode 755406

## Deploying the Gatewick Proctor Queue

Deploys are pretty painless: push to main, wait for the pipeline, then watch the queue drain dashboard for five minutes. If candidates pile up mid-exam, roll back first and ask questions later — the queue replays safely. Everything the workers care about lives in one config block, shown here for reference.

settings of bafof-yagef:
JOROX_PIN=8740
JOROX_TENANT=pelox
JOROX_METRICS_HOST=metrics.jorox.qorvelworks.internal
JOROX_SEAL=seal_c78f63c1
JOROX_STANDBY_TEAM=norax